Output 1bf82e802451a033b9618c65c4d0303d0f9628c18a97be25e294035643981c49:0

value
2659640
script pubkey
OP_0 OP_PUSHBYTES_20 689d5306c5127edac8187ee28be33bf83b79603a
address
bc1qdzw4xpk9zfld4jqc0m3ghcemlqahjcp6eynkxh
transaction
1bf82e802451a033b9618c65c4d0303d0f9628c18a97be25e294035643981c49
spent
true